Output 91c359156aa87a1e6dd7a376bc98e647ff8150ed1dec029962d6f72d814f4b7a:0

value
42309
script pubkey
OP_0 OP_PUSHBYTES_20 e0a0e4a7107db7e51c36e1d4732b548493f5a89e
address
tb1quzswffcs0km728pku828x265sjflt2y7uw3sxm
transaction
91c359156aa87a1e6dd7a376bc98e647ff8150ed1dec029962d6f72d814f4b7a